How to Install LED Strips on Angled Cabinets

To install LED strips on angled cabinets, measure the cabinet dimensions accurately to identify the required length. Choose LED strips with a minimum brightness of 200 lumens per foot and a color temperature between 3000K to 5000K. Clean the surfaces with a degreaser and denatured alcohol for ideal adhesion. Cut the strips to fit, ensuring a proper connection while maintaining polarity. Secure the strips with adhesive or mounting clips. For improved usability, consider integrating a dimmer switch. Cleaning and Prepping the Surface for Adhesion

surface cleaning for adhesion

Cleaning the surface of angled cabinets is essential for ensuring strong adhesion of LED strips. Begin the cleaning process by applying a degreasing cleaner to the undersides of the cabinets. This will effectively remove dust, grease, and residues that could hinder adhesion. After thorough cleaning, wipe the surfaces with rubbing alcohol, ensuring that any moisture evaporates completely. It is vital to use a soft cloth to dry the surfaces thoroughly, as a wet surface can prevent the adhesive backing from sealing properly. Additionally, check for any obstructions or damage that may interfere with the installation. Adequate ventilation should be maintained throughout this process to promote safe working conditions and enhance the effectiveness of adhesion. Cutting and Aligning LED Strips

cutting and aligning led strips

Starting the process of cutting and aligning LED strips requires careful measurement and planning. First, accurately measure the length of the cabinet edges, adjusting for any angles. Next, utilize a sharp pair of scissors or a utility knife, cutting the LED strips at the designated points marked by dashed lines. This guarantees clean edges, essential for precise aligning. When working with angled surfaces, visualize the layout beforehand to confirm that the strips fit snugly along the edge. Apply the adhesive backing smoothly, ensuring no bubbles exist, allowing for unobstructed light distribution. Finally, consider securing the strips further with mounting clips on angled sections to prevent slipping due to gravity or uneven surfaces. Each step enhances the installation’s effectiveness. Wiring and Connecting Your LED Lighting

After successfully mounting LED strips, attention must now turn to wiring and connecting the lighting system. Begin by gathering essential tools such as fish tape for maneuvering wires through tight spaces and wire strippers for secure connections. Remember, do not exceed the typical maximum length of 16 feet for LED strips, to avoid voltage drop issues. It is vital to connect the LED lights in accordance with their polarity. Ascertain the positive terminal of the power supply connects to the positive end of the strip. Consider incorporating a dimmer switch compatible with LED lights for enhanced control over brightness. Once wired, regularly check and secure all connections to prevent damage from movement or heat buildup. Testing the Lights and Final Adjustments

Upon energizing the power supply, the LED strips should be tested to verify all connections function correctly and securely. Begin by checking for even illumination across the surfaces. Observe brightness levels from various angles, particularly near the countertop and backsplash. If flickering occurs, this may indicate connection issues or polarity mistakes. Adjust the positioning of the LED strips during final adjustments to enhance areas lacking adequate brightness. Aim for consistent lighting by making certain the strips are evenly spaced and properly aligned. Finally, manage wires and cables neatly to prevent exposure and maintain a clean installation appearance. These steps guarantee the finished product not only looks professional but functions effectively in the intended space. Why Do My LED Strips Keep Falling Off?

LED strips may fall off due to insufficient surface preparation, poor adhesive qualities, or improper adhering methods. Additionally, heat management and environmental conditions can compromise adhesion, undermining the effectiveness of the installation over time.
